    Went here for a night out with some friends and had a great time! We did get bottle service and our…read moreown separate area behind the DJ which probably helped too because it definitely got packed as the night went on. The space is 70s themed and they have two disco balls right in the center of the dance floor. The music was mostly 70s right when we went around 8 but as the night went on they mixed in a lot more genres. So everyone will find something they like. The DJ definitely could have been better though. They rotated through songs really fast so just as we were getting into something it was already changing. Service at the bar was really friendly and prices aren't unreasonable. Cocktails were tasty, albeit a little sweet.
